We somewhat mitigate that by requiring (requesting really, > > because it gets skipped) overlays to be applied to *something* at > > build time, but that's the kernel tree which isn't everything. > > Yeah, the suggested patch is also not a good solution, comments on > that email. > For #address-cells/#size-cells, you can also have the properties set in the dtso file either in the __overlay__ node or if, some other DT properties are needed, in the fragment node. https://elixir.bootlin.com/linux/v7.1/source/drivers/misc/lan966x_pci.dtso#L25 Worth noting that, in linux code, when an overlay is applied if #address-cells and/or #size-cells are identical to already existing ones, its fine. Otherwise, an error is returned. https://elixir.bootlin.com/linux/v7.1/source/drivers/of/overlay.c#L322 We can have dtc checking reg values against #address-cells/#size-cells and when the overlay is applied, there is guarantees the #address-cells/#size-cells matches base DT existing ones. It is not yet perfect but it is better than nothing. Best regards, Hervé
